Transaction 75ca5de162924d5ac0e3857c21b3ec758691b3a9f66d5ce3a2d8d6ab869285ba
1 Input
1 Output
-
75ca5de162924d5ac0e3857c21b3ec758691b3a9f66d5ce3a2d8d6ab869285ba:0
- value
- 14751
- script pubkey
- OP_0 OP_PUSHBYTES_20 824f59a584920704bc70dfc203c812b768130256
- address
- bc1qsf84nfvyjgrsf0rsmlpq8jqjka5pxqjkj9n0ca